Kool & The Gang Play Baloise Session
Kool & The Gang has sold over 70 million albums worldwide and influenced the music of three generations. They've have earned two Grammy Awards, seven American Music Awards, 25 Top Ten R&B hits, nine Top Ten Pop hits, and 31 gold and platinum albums.
